发表评论取消回复
相关阅读
相关 线程池之ThreadPoolExecutor源码解析
1.变量 ThreadPoolExecutor先定义了这几个常量,初看时一脸懵逼,其实它就是用int的二进制高三位来表示线程池的状态, 先回顾一下位运算: 1. <<’
相关 ThreadPoolExecutor线程池类使用解析
在Java并发编程中,使用线程池技术对于系统性能的提升是非常大的,通过对线程的统一管理,我们可以重复利用已经创建的线程来执行任务,有效避免频繁的线程创建和销毁带来的资源消耗。
相关 线程池ThreadPoolExecutor参数简析
创建线程池推荐使用ThreadPoolExecutor,而不是Executors Executors包含四种创建线程池的方法 1. newFixedThreadPool:
相关 JAVA ThreadPoolExecutor线程池参数设置技巧
JAVA ThreadPoolExecutor线程池参数设置技巧 之前发了一篇文章还是在学校的时候,很久没有回到慕课学习了。 加入公司,成为一名程序员已经过了大
相关 ThreadPoolExecutor线程池参数设置技巧
一、ThreadPoolExecutor的重要参数 corePoolSize:核心线程数 核心线程会一直存活,及时没有任务需要执行 当线程数小于核心线程数时
相关 Java线程池ThreadPoolExecutor参数解析
ThreadPoolExecutor构造函数 public ThreadPoolExecutor(int corePoolSize,
相关 Java线程池ThreadPoolExecutor原理解析
在Java中,使用线程池来异步执行一些耗时任务是非常常见的操作。最初我们一般都是直接使用`new Thread().start`的方式,但我们知道,线程的创建和销毁都会
相关 线程池 ThreadPoolExecutor解析
`ThreadPoolExecutor`中的几个比较重要的成员变量: private final BlockingQueue<Runnable> workQueue;
相关 ThreadPoolExecutor线程池参数设置技巧
一、ThreadPoolExecutor的重要参数 corePoolSize:核心线程数 核心线程会一直存活,及时没有任务需要执行
还没有评论,来说两句吧...